How to Tell if Panerai is Genuine:
1. Authenticity Card: Genuine Panerai watches come with an authenticity card that includes details such as the model number, serial number, and the official Panerai stamp. Be wary of sellers on Instagram who cannot provide this card.
2. Quality of Materials: Panerai watches are known for their high-quality materials, including stainless steel, titanium, and sapphire crystal. Inspect the watch closely for any signs of cheap materials or poor craftsmanship.
3. Movement: Panerai watches are equipped with Swiss-made movements, such as those from ETA or in-house movements like the P.9000 series. Fake Panerai watches often use low-quality movements that do not provide accurate timekeeping.
4. Engraving and Markings: Genuine Panerai watches feature precise and crisp engravings on the case back, crown, and clasp. Look for any inconsistencies or smudged markings that may indicate a fake watch.

How to Tell if Panerai Watch is Real:
1. Serial Number: Every genuine Panerai watch comes with a unique serial number engraved on the case back. Verify this number with Panerai's official database to ensure its authenticity.
2. Dial and Hands: Examine the dial and hands of the watch for any imperfections or inconsistencies. Genuine Panerai watches have precise printing and lume on the hands that glow brightly in the dark.
3. Water Resistance: Panerai watches are known for their water resistance, with most models being rated for at least 100 meters. Fake Panerai watches may not have proper water resistance seals or testing.

Knockoff Panerai Watches:
1. Poor Quality Materials: Knockoff Panerai watches are typically made with cheap materials such as low-grade stainless steel and plastic crystals. These watches are prone to scratches and tarnishing over time.
2. Inaccurate Markings: Fake Panerai watches often have misspelled words, incorrect logos, or inconsistent engravings that give away their counterfeit nature. Inspect the watch carefully for any signs of inauthenticity.
3. Lack of Warranty: Genuine Panerai watches come with a manufacturer's warranty that covers defects in materials and workmanship. Knockoff Panerai watches do not offer any warranty or after-sales support.
